THUNDER BAY – Freezing drizzle is making roadways and sidewalks slippery tonight. The conditions are expected to taper off overnight.

Conditions are also slippery east of Thunder Bay.

Freezing drizzle advisory in effect for:

  • Thunder Bay
  • Cloud Bay – Dorion
  • Kakabeka Falls – Whitefish Lake – Arrow Lake

Areas of freezing drizzle are expected or occurring.

Freezing drizzle is falling over much of the area and will persist this evening before tapering off overnight.

Untreated surfaces may be icy and slippery.

Surfaces such as highways, roads, walkways and parking lots may become icy and slippery. Slow down driving in slippery conditions. Watch for taillights ahead and maintain a safe following distance.
